@charset "UTF-8";
/* CSS Document */
body { padding-top: 70px; }

.mae {
    animation-name: fadein;
    animation-duration: 2s;
}
@keyframes fadein {
from {
    opacity: 0;
    transform: translateY(20px);
}
to {
    opacity: 1;
    transform: translateY(0);
}
}

.navbar {
	background-color : transparent; /* ヘッダの背景色 */
	background-color : #2F2F2F; /* ヘッダの背景色 黒を指定*/
/* 半透明にする*/
filter:alpha(opacity=50);
-moz-opacity: 0.9;
opacity: 0.9;
}

/* タブ*/
.pill-1 a {
    color: #5DC9DB;
}
.pill-2 a {
    color: #5DC9DB;
}
.pill-3 a {
    color: #5DC9DB;
}
.pill-4 a {
    color: #5DC9DB;
}
.pill-5 a {
    color: #5DC9DB;
}
.nav-pills .nav-link.active, .nav-pills .show > .nav-link {
    color: #fff;
    background-color: #5DC9DB;
}

#kengaku {
	font-size: 13px;
}

.name {
    margin-top: 25px;
    margin-bottom: 5px;
    margin-left: 25px
}
.bun {
    font-size: 12pt;
    margin-top:inherit;
    margin-left: 45px;
    margin-bottom: inherit;
}

.kakko {
    margin-top: 5px;
    margin-left: 45px;
    font-size: 8px;
}

.a1 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a2 {
     font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a3 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a4 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a5 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a6 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}
.a7 {
    font-size: 11pt;
  padding: 0.5em;/*文字周りの余白*/
  color: #494949;/*文字色*/
  background: #EDF5F6;/*背景色*/
  border-left: solid 5px #5DC9DB;/*左線（実線 太さ 色）*/
}

/* フッター */
#footer {
    background-color: #DADADA;
    width: 100%;
    padding-top: 15px;
    padding-bottom: 15px;
}
#p1 {
    font-size: 10pt;
    color: #282828;
}
#p2 {
    font-size: 9pt;
    color: #282828;
}
#p3 {
    font-size: 7.5pt;
    color: #282828;
}
#p4 {
    font-size: 7pt;
    color: #444444;
    margin-top: 20px;
}